Situated on SW facing slope of rising ground in upland area. Large raised circular area (diam 35m; ext. H 1.5m) enclosed by an earth and stone bank severely eroded to a scarp in most places with enclosing fosse (Wth 5m; ext. D 0.5m) and possible outer bank (Wth. 2m; ext. H 1m; int. H 0.5m) now used as a field boundary which appears to mainly consist of field clearance material. Causewayed entrance gap (Wth 2.5m) at S. The interior is poorly preserved with spoil heap from a silage pit dumped in N sector of site.
The above description is derived from the published 'Archaeological Inventory of County Offaly' (Dublin: Stationery Office, 1997). In certain instances the entries have been revised and updated in the light of recent research.
